2016-05-11 3 views
0

Как бы вы делили константы между двумя базовыми классами?Обмен константами между двумя базовыми классами

Черты не дают констант, и это был мой первый инстинкт. Я не хочу их определять в конфигурационных файлах, потому что они не предназначены для совместного использования всем приложением.

+4

Создать родительский класс с вашим постоянными и расширить этот класс этих 2 классов? –

ответ

0

Для этого конкретного решения я закончил создание интерфейса с константами и его реализацию на базовых классах, которые им были нужны.

Посмотрите на этот вопрос для справки:

PHP Traits - defining generic constants

Смежные вопросы